NZX trading keeps rising

12:26 pm on 6 June 2012

Trading on the New Zealand stockmarket continues to pick up.

NZX statistics show almost 96,000 trades were made in May, almost a third more than in the same month a year earlier.

But the value of trades slipped by more than 13% in the same period, to $2.5 billion.

The market capitalisation stood at $58.4 billion at the end of May, 1.8% less than a year earlier.
